The Moto G has an overall score of 60.3, which is slightly better than Acer Liquid E2's 55.7 overall score. The Moto G is a thicker and just a little heavier phone than the Acer Liquid E2. Both of these phones work with Android OS, but Moto G has newer 5.0 version and Acer Liquid E2 has Android 4.2.1, counting with a lot of extra features.
The Motorola Moto G's processor is very similar to the Acer Liquid E2 one, and although the Motorola Moto G has a faster 450 MHz GPU, they both have a 1 GB RAM memory and 4 cores. Motorola Moto G has a bit sharper screen than Acer Liquid E2, and although they both have a display of the same size, the Motorola Moto G also has a higher 1280 x 720 pixels resolution and a better number of pixels per screen inch.
The Acer Liquid E2 features a bigger storage for applications and games than Moto G, because although it has 0 less internal storage, it also counts with a SD extension slot that allows up to 32 GB. The Moto G counts with a bit better battery life than Acer Liquid E2, because it has 2070mAh of battery capacity instead of 2000mAh.
The Acer Liquid E2 has a little bit better camera than Motorola Moto G, because it has a back-facing camera with much more mega pixels and a lot higher (Full HD) video definition.
Even being the best phone of the ones we compare here, Moto G is also a lot cheaper, which makes this phone an obvious call.
